Export -PowerPoint - Embed Live Data available for B2B guest users ?

Hi ,

 

In my tenant, there are B2B guest user invited, I have power BI premium capacity and share the reports to the B2B guest users via Premium Workspaces.

 

Recently, I noticed that there is a new festure released from Power BI Service, user can select to connect to the live report data from Power Point by clicking the export -> powerpoint menu:

 

Previously, there is only one option "Embed an image" .

The B2B users can select this option to embed the live data, however, when open the PowerPoint, there is error displayed:

WendyNHK_1-1657596348589.png

The error details:

 

Http Status Code: 401
Error Code: GroupNotAccessible

Error Time: 2022-07-12T02:47:55.629Z

Cluster URI: https://WABI-AUSTRALIA-EAST-A-PRIMARY-redirect.analysis.windows.net
Api URI: https://api.powerbi.com
Build: 13.0.18578.34
Office Host: PowerPoint
Platform: PC
PPT Version: 16.0.15330.20230

 

The B2B user has M365 enterprise subscription in his home tenant and the B2B guest user can embed the live data from the report in his home tenant successfully. 

 

In my tenant there is no M365 subscription.  Is this the problem ? or is the B2B user type a problem ?

 

"Embed an image" works totally fine for all the B2B users. If the "Embed live data " does not work for B2B guest users, I want to check whether this "Embed live data " option can be disabled ? But I still need the "Embed an image"  option enabled.

Now my issue was resoved as Microsoft mentioned that B2B user does not have this capability in the limitation section on their official learning document.
